When Should You Book Newborn Photography in Perth?
The best time for newborn photos Perth parents can plan for is during pregnancy, ideally in your second or early third trimester.
Not because anything dramatic happens if you don’t, but because it gives us space to plan properly without the stress.

Best Age for Newborn Photography in Perth
Most newborn sessions are done when your baby is around 7 to 14 days old.
At this stage, babies are still very sleepy, curled up, and naturally settle easily into those soft, connected moments.
That doesn’t mean older babies cannot be photographed beautifully, they absolutely can, but the feel of the session does change as they start to wake up more and stretch out.


What happens if you miss that window?
First, don’t panic.
There is no “too late” for beautiful photos.
But what does change is the style of the session.
Older babies (3 to 6 weeks plus) are often more alert, more expressive, and a little less settled into those womb-like sleepy poses.
And honestly, that can be just as beautiful in a completely different way. More eye contact. More personality. More connection between you and your baby as they start to wake up to the world.
It is just different, not worse.
